Output 7e7a34566eb0ccbec7805e1772037cc41fbd567fe49d38f4c8b8ec6cd5d9426d:0

value
10361679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26517f6ba05087c3e184e829b27afee464e39ff7 OP_EQUAL
address
35BdEPsyAVasQmLX8PeMVVRDTFSX2LLLEy
transaction
7e7a34566eb0ccbec7805e1772037cc41fbd567fe49d38f4c8b8ec6cd5d9426d
confirmations
177799
spent
true